What Is It?
Near miss and incident reporting is a critical safety function that captures potential hazards and actual safety events before they result in injuries or losses. Currently, many plants struggle with inconsistent reporting due to manual processes, delayed submissions, accessibility barriers, and lack of accountability—leaving safety blind spots and preventing organizational learning. Smart manufacturing transforms this capability through mobile-first reporting platforms, automated hazard detection sensors, real-time notification systems, and analytics dashboards that make reporting frictionless, immediate, and visible across the entire operation. By lowering barriers to entry and creating transparency, plants shift from reactive incident management to proactive hazard prevention, while building a strong safety culture where every employee feels empowered and responsible for reporting.
Why Is It Important?
Real-time near miss and incident reporting directly reduces injury rates, workers' compensation costs, and regulatory penalties—typically saving organizations $2–5 per dollar invested in safety infrastructure. Plants with accessible, transparent reporting systems experience 30–50% fewer repeat incidents because root cause insights propagate immediately across teams, preventing latent hazards from evolving into catastrophic failures. Organizations that shift from reactive incident cleanup to proactive hazard visibility gain competitive advantage through lower insurance premiums, faster regulatory compliance, and stronger workforce retention—safety becomes a measurable operational asset, not just a compliance checkbox.
- →Faster Hazard Detection & Response: Real-time mobile reporting and automated sensor alerts enable safety teams to identify and mitigate risks within minutes rather than days, preventing incidents before they escalate into injuries or losses.
- →Reduced Injury Rates & Workers Compensation: Proactive hazard identification and corrective action closure tracking demonstrably lower TRIR and lost-time incidents, directly reducing insurance premiums and productivity losses from employee absences.
- →Improved Safety Culture & Engagement: Removing friction from reporting—via mobile-first design, simplified workflows, and visible feedback loops—encourages frontline workers to report near misses without fear, shifting mindset from concealment to collective learning.
- →Data-Driven Root Cause Analysis: Centralized analytics dashboards reveal patterns across location, shift, equipment, and job category, enabling targeted interventions and evidence-based safety investments rather than reactive firefighting.
- →Regulatory Compliance & Audit Readiness: Automated logging, timestamping, and closure tracking create auditable safety records that satisfy OSHA, ISO 45001, and industry-specific requirements while reducing compliance documentation burden.
- →Accountability & Ownership Visibility: Real-time dashboards showing open incidents, assigned owners, and closure status create transparency and accountability, ensuring safety actions don't slip through cracks and building management commitment to resolution.
Who Is Involved?
Suppliers
- •Mobile devices and IoT sensors deployed on the shop floor that capture environmental hazards, near-miss observations, and incident events in real-time.
- •Plant safety teams and EHS personnel who define reporting categories, hazard taxonomies, and escalation thresholds that structure how incidents are classified.
- •Production supervisors and frontline workers who observe and witness potential hazards, unsafe conditions, and near-miss events throughout daily operations.
- •Legacy incident management systems and document repositories that contain historical incident data and lessons learned for pattern analysis.
Process
- •Mobile application allows workers to submit near-miss and incident reports with photos, location tags, and hazard descriptions using intuitive forms that require minimal training.
- •Automated hazard detection sensors (vision systems, thermal imaging, gas sensors) continuously monitor equipment and environmental conditions for precursor signals of unsafe states.
- •Real-time notification and escalation engine immediately alerts relevant supervisors, safety teams, and management based on severity level and hazard type.
- •Analytics dashboard aggregates and visualizes all reports with trend analysis, heat maps by location/shift, and root cause categorization to identify systemic safety gaps.
Customers
- •Site safety managers and EHS directors who receive consolidated incident data and analytics to drive corrective actions, trend investigations, and preventive safety improvements.
- •Production supervisors and team leads who access real-time alerts and reports to immediately respond to hazards and counsel workers on safe work practices.
- •Frontline workers who receive feedback on their reports, see status updates, and gain visibility into how their safety observations drive plant-wide improvements.
- •Plant operations leadership and site management who use incident dashboards and KPIs to assess safety culture maturity and allocate resources for risk mitigation.
Other Stakeholders
- •Corporate safety and risk management functions that aggregate site-level data to identify enterprise-wide hazard patterns and benchmark safety performance across facilities.
- •Employee wellness and occupational health teams who use incident data to understand exposure patterns and target health monitoring or ergonomic interventions.
- •Regulatory compliance and audit functions that reference incident reports and trending analysis to demonstrate due diligence and preparedness for third-party inspections.
- •Insurance and risk management partners who access anonymized trend data to assess claim risk and inform coverage recommendations for the facility.
